Output d62bc7b546f61d6d7d1fb13c001ab5ebffcdcc95d32769d2091fd6d3c37bf809:3

value
6420407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79103438bbf0d5a45d06751a6de64e68c0d8a56f OP_EQUAL
address
3Cj96dPfyPVVcYKMa4SirPX9EbNkTfL2rw
transaction
d62bc7b546f61d6d7d1fb13c001ab5ebffcdcc95d32769d2091fd6d3c37bf809
spent
true